Literature summary for 3.4.21.10 extracted from

  • Suter, L.; Habenicht, U.F.
    Characterization of mouse epididymal acrosin: comparative studies with acrosin from boar and human ejaculated spermatozoa (1998), Int. J. Androl., 21, 95-104.

Subunits

Subunits Comment Organism
? x * 55000-59000, SDS-PAGE, doublet Sus scrofa
? x * 52000-54000, SDS-PAGE, doublet Mus musculus
? x * 58000-60000, SDS-PAGE, doublet Homo sapiens
